Multiple voters in Brooklyn told Gothamist / WNYC that they have received a mislabeled “official absentee ballot envelope.” Normally, the voter inserts their completed ballot into the envelope and signs the outside. But in these cases, their ballot envelopes bear the wrong name and address. If a person signs their own name to this faulty ballot envelope, the ballot would be voided.

History Hit
On 12 April 1916, Naik Shahamad Khan of the 89th Punjabis was serving in Mesopotamia when he earned the Victoria Cross for his valour.
Khan was in charge of a machine gun in an exposed position, covering a gap in the British lines. He beat off three enemy attacks and worked the gun single-handed when most of his men became casualties. After his gun was knocked out, he and two men held off the enemy with their rifles.
When his section finally withdrew, Khan brought back a severely wounded man, then returned to remove the section’s arms and ammunition.
